How Smart Is Your Right Foot?
This is something I got in an email chain. Probably a lot of you have already seen it. But it's pretty weird, and it's true -- at least for me.

This is so funny that it will boggle your mind. Moreover, you may keep
trying more times to see if you can outsmart your foot, but you can't.

1. While sitting at your desk, lift your right foot off the floor and make clockwise circles.

2. Now, while doing this, draw the number 6 in the air with your right hand. Your foot will change direction.
